WebThe following two switched outlet wiring diagrams depict how split or half switched outlets can be wired. The first one shows the method with the neutral conductor in the switch box. The bottom drawing shows how it is usually done. Split outlets are standard duplex outlets that have had their tabs cut to separate the top and bottom. WebIdeally, you should spread as many outlets around your home as possible and assign them to a single circuit. Just keep in mind the maximum load for a single circuit. A good rule of thumb is to assume that there will be a maximum power draw of 1.5 amps for each outlet, allowing 10 outlets for a single 20-amp circuit.

Web14 dec. 2024 · The 120V outlets in your camper van need to get their power from a breaker box. Here is how to wire the 120V circuits to the camper breaker box: Connect the ‘Hot’ (Black) wire to the breaker. Connect the ‘Neutral’ (White) wire to the Neutral Busbar. Connect the ‘Ground’ (Green) wire to the Ground Busbar.
